Unite's reaction to the expansion of Heathrow consultation

23 November 2007

Unite national officer, Brian Boyd says, "Unite welcomes the DfT's consultation on the future of Heathrow. Standing still is not an option. The expansion of Heathrow is absolutely essential for the creation of quality jobs in the civil aviation industry and maintaining Heathrow's position as an international hub. Heathrow is a major economic driver of London's economy and the UK as a whole. Unless Heathrow expands this prime position is under threat."

"London is in grave danger of losing out to Frankfurt, Paris and Amsterdam unless we push ahead with a third runway. We recognise that there are environmental challenges which need to be addressed but we need to have a balanced debate on this issue. As the UK's main civil aviation union we intend to participate fully in this consultation and we will bring the views and opinions of our broad membership to this debate."

Unite is the largest civil transport union in the UK with over 70,000 members. The union's membership includes; cabin crew, check-in staff, engineers, security, baggage handlers, fire-fighters, administrative and back office staff.
